目录
- 前言
- 为什么选择Vultr和ShadowsocksR
- Vultr VPS上搭建ShadowsocksR服务器 3.1 注册Vultr账号 3.2 创建Vultr VPS 3.3 在VPS上安装ShadowsocksR
- 配置ShadowsocksR客户端 4.1 Windows客户端配置 4.2 Mac客户端配置 4.3 iOS客户端配置 4.4 Android客户端配置
- 测试连接和使用
- ShadowsocksR常见问题解答 6.1 ShadowsocksR和VPN有什么区别? 6.2 ShadowsocksR是否安全? 6.3 ShadowsocksR会被墙吗? 6.4 ShadowsocksR有哪些优势?
- 总结
1. 前言
在当今互联网高度管控的环境下,如何突破网络封锁,自由上网成为许多用户的迫切需求。作为一种广受欢迎的科学上网方式,ShadowsocksR凭借其高效、稳定、安全的特点,备受用户青睐。
本文将为大家详细介绍如何在Vultr VPS上搭建ShadowsocksR服务器,并配置各类客户端,让您轻松实现科学上网。同时,我们还将解答ShadowsocksR使用过程中的常见问题,帮助您更好地了解和使用这款优秀的科学上网工具。
2. 为什么选择Vultr和ShadowsocksR
Vultr是一家美国知名的云服务提供商,拥有遍布全球的数据中心,提供高性能的VPS服务。Vultr不仅提供稳定的网络环境,而且在隐私保护方面也有出色表现,深受用户信赖。
ShadowsocksR是一款基于Socks5代理的科学上网工具,它采用加密传输的方式,可以有效避开各种网络封锁,为用户提供快速、安全的上网体验。ShadowsocksR具有丰富的协议和插件支持,能够根据不同网络环境进行灵活调整,保证稳定可靠的连接。
将Vultr和ShadowsocksR相结合,用户可以在海外高速VPS的基础上,配合ShadowsocksR的强大功能,轻松实现科学上网,是一种非常不错的选择。
3. Vultr VPS上搭建ShadowsocksR服务器
3.1 注册Vultr账号
首先,您需要前往Vultr官网(www.vultr.com)注册一个账号。注册过程非常简单,只需要填写基本的个人信息即可。
注册完成后,您需要进行实名认证,这是Vultr为了确保账号安全而设置的必要步骤。认证通过后,您就可以开始使用Vultr提供的各项服务了。
3.2 创建Vultr VPS
登录Vultr账号后,进入控制面板,点击”Deploy New Server”按钮,选择合适的VPS配置,如内存、CPU、硬盘等。
*重要提示:*为了保证科学上网的稳定性和安全性,建议选择位于海外的数据中心,如美国、日本等地。
配置完成后,点击”Deploy Now”按钮即可创建VPS。创建完成后,您就可以在控制面板中看到新创建的VPS实例了。
3.3 在VPS上安装ShadowsocksR
接下来,我们需要在Vultr VPS上安装并配置ShadowsocksR服务端。
首先,通过SSH远程连接到您的Vultr VPS。连接成功后,依次执行以下命令:
bash
apt-get update apt-get install -y python3 python3-pip
git clone https://github.com/shadowsocksrr/shadowsocksr.git cd shadowsocksr pip3 install -r requirements.txt
安装完成后,您需要修改ShadowsocksR的配置文件,设置服务器端口、密码、加密方式等参数。具体操作如下:
bash
vi user-config.json
在配置文件中,您需要修改以下关键参数:
server
: 服务器IP地址,一般为Vultr VPS的公网IPserver_port
: 服务器监听端口password
: 连接密码method
: 加密方式
修改完成后,保存退出。然后启动ShadowsocksR服务端:
bash
python3 shadowsocks/server.py -c user-config.json
至此,Vultr VPS上的ShadowsocksR服务器就已经成功搭建完毕。接下来,我们需要配置客户端,以便能够连接到这台服务器。
4. 配置ShadowsocksR客户端
ShadowsocksR提供了多种客户端,支持Windows、macOS、iOS、Android等主流操作系统。下面我们将分别介绍各类客户端的配置方法。
4.1 Windows客户端配置
- 下载Windows版ShadowsocksR客户端:https://github.com/shadowsocksrr/shadowsocksr-csharp/releases
- 解压缩并运行客户端程序
- 右击任务栏图标,选择”服务器”>”编辑服务器”4. 在弹出的窗口中,填写刚刚在Vultr VPS上设置的服务器地址、端口、密码和加密方式
- 点击”确定”保存设置
- 再次右击任务栏图标,选择”连接”即可开始使用
4.2 Mac客户端配置
- 下载Mac版ShadowsocksR客户端:https://github.com/shadowsocksrr/ShadowsocksX-NG/releases
- 解压缩并运行客户端程序
- 点击菜单栏图标,选择”服务器”>”编辑服务器”4. 在弹出的窗口中,填写Vultr VPS的服务器地址、端口、密码和加密方式
- 点击”确定”保存设置
- 再次点击菜单栏图标,选择”服务器”>”服务器1″即可连接
4.3 iOS客户端配置
- 在App Store搜索并下载”Shadowrocket”应用
- 运行Shadowrocket,点击左上角的”+”号
- 选择”手动配置”,填写Vultr VPS的服务器地址、端口、密码和加密方式
- 点击”完成”保存配置
- 启用Shadowrocket即可连接
4.4 Android客户端配置
- 在Google Play搜索并下载”ShadowsocksR”应用
- 运行ShadowsocksR,点击右下角的”+”号
- 填写Vultr VPS的服务器地址、端口、密码和加密方式
- 点击”保存”即可
- 启用ShadowsocksR即可连接
5. 测试连接和使用
配置完成后,您可以通过一些在线测试工具,如speedtest.net,测试您的网络连接速度和稳定性。如果一切正常,您就可以开始尽情地科学上网了。
除了常规的网页浏览,ShadowsocksR还支持多种应用程序的代理连接,如YouTube、Netflix、Twitter等。只需在相应应用程序的设置中,配置ShadowsocksR的代理即可。
6. ShadowsocksR常见问题解答
6.1 ShadowsocksR和VPN有什么区别?
ShadowsocksR是一种基于Socks5代理的科学上网工具,它采用加密传输的方式绕过网络封锁。VPN则是一种虚拟专用网络技术,可以将您的网络流量加密并转发到VPN服务器上。两者在功能上都可以实现科学上网,但ShadowsocksR相比VPN更加轻量、灵活,同时也更加安全。
6.2 ShadowsocksR是否安全?
ShadowsocksR采用加密传输技术,能够有效防止您的网络活动被监听和窃取。此外,ShadowsocksR还支持多种加密算法和协议,可以根据网络环境进行灵活调整,提高安全性。总的来说,ShadowsocksR是一款非常安全可靠的科学上网工具。
6.3 ShadowsocksR会被墙吗?
由于ShadowsocksR采用加密传输,能够有效规避网络审查和封锁,因此被墙的概率相对较低。不过,随着网络管控的不断升级,ShadowsocksR也可能会受到一定影响。为了确保长期稳定使用,建议您选择支持多种协议和插件的ShadowsocksR版本,并定期关注相关信息的更新。
6.4 ShadowsocksR有哪些优势?
- 速度快:ShadowsocksR采用Socks5代理,相比VPN具有更低的网络开销,能够提供更快的上网速度。
- 稳定性强:ShadowsocksR支持多种协议和插件,可以根据网络环境进行灵活调整,保证连接的稳定性。
- 隐私安全:ShadowsocksR采用加密传输技术,能有效防止您的网络活动被监听和窃取。
- 使用简单:ShadowsocksR客户端操作简单,配置方便,即使是新手也能轻松上手。
- 跨平台支持:ShadowsocksR提供了Windows、macOS、iOS、Android等主流操作系统的客户端,适用性广。
7. 总结
通过本文的详细介绍,相信您已经掌握了在Vultr VPS上搭建ShadowsocksR服务器,以及配置各类客户端的完整方法。ShadowsocksR凭借其出色的性能和安全性,已经成为许多用户首选的科学上网工具。
希望本文对您有所帮助。如果在使用过程中还有任何疑问,欢迎随时与我们联系交流。祝您科学上网愉快!